Latest web development tutorials

jQuery .promise () Método

Métodos variados jQuery Métodos variados jQuery

Exemplos

.promise Chamada em um set de filmagem não é activado ()

$ (Function () { var div = $ ( "<Div />" ); .. Div promessa () feito (function ( arg1 ) { // Pop "true" alert ( este === div && arg1 === div );});})

tente »

Definição e Uso

.promise () retorna um objeto Promise observar algum tipo de ação é obrigado a todas as coleções, se foi adicionado à fila.


Nota: 1. .promise () retorna uma promessa gerado dinamicamente, quando ligado à recolha de todas as acções específicas (ação) foi adicionado ou não adicionado à fila, a promessa resultante será aceite (resolver) .
O valor padrão é 2. Tipo "fx", o que significa que para se divertir (resolver) a promessa objetos são selecionados quando todos os elementos estiverem concluídas animação retornado.
3. Se você fornecer parâmetros de destino, .promise () para adicionar esse parâmetro, em seguida, retornar o objeto, em vez de criar um novo. Aplica-se a uma situação em um objeto que já existe para adicionar comportamento Promise.


gramática

.promise( [type ] [, target ] )

参数 描述
type String类型 需要待观察队列类型。
target PlainObject类型 将要绑定 promise 方法的对象。


Exemplos

mais exemplos

Chamada aceitar devoluções de final Promise da animação
Quando todo o final da animação (incluindo aqueles no callback animação e, em seguida, adicionar a função de retorno de animação inicializado), recebendo (Resolve) retornou Promise.

Use $ .quando () declaração aceitando Promise devolvido
Use (método .promise () para que se torne possível alcançar na coleção jQuery) $ .quando () declaração, recebendo (Resolve) retornou Promise.


Métodos variados jQuery Métodos variados jQuery